Detailed Solution

In the quadrilateral AQBS, 

AQ = BS = 5 cm and AQ || BS.

∴ AQBS is a parallelogram.

⇒ AS || BQ

Converse of mid-point theorem states that the line drawn through the mid-point of one side of a triangle, which is parallel to another side, bisects the third side of the triangle.

In ΔPDQ, 

A is the mid-point of PQ and AC is parallel to DQ.

∴ PC = CD

Hence, CD = 3 cm

In ΔSRC, 

B is the mid-point of SR and SC is parallel to BD.

∴ CD = DR

⇒ DR = 3 cm

∴ PR = PC + CD + DR = (3 + 3 + 3) cm = 9 cm

Thus, the length of PR is 9 cm.
